As a Senior Executive in SingHealth Group Office of Patient Experience, you will support the Assistant Director in the planning and execution of programmes that drive patient engagement. Through partnerships with patients and/or their families and caregivers, you will work with healthcare professionals across SingHealth to improve health services. This includes conceptualising and implementing key events that position SingHealth as a leader in patient engagement and patient advocacy programmes. The scope of work includes planning, publicity, vendor management, cross-liaison with various stakeholders, and review of award criteria and award presentation format.

 

Another key responsibility will be to provide support relating to recruitment, onboarding and training of SingHealth Patient Advocacy Network (SPAN) members to build a strong network of empowered patient advisors who volunteer their experiences to improve the quality and safety of care and services. You will also assist in extending the outreach of SPAN’s work by introducing new communication channels on social media and working with SingHealth institutions to create institution-based SPANs. Close collaboration with local and international counterparts will also be expected for SPAN to remain relevant.

 

Other duties include assisting in the handling and management of feedback via the hotline and email and representing the department in organisation-wide initiatives.
